Strategic Position
KWG Group Holdings Limited is a Chinese property developer primarily engaged in the development and sale of residential and commercial properties, as well as property investment and hotel operations. The company focuses on developing large-scale residential communities, integrated commercial complexes, and office buildings, with a significant presence in first- and second-tier cities in China, particularly in the Greater Bay Area. KWG positions itself as a mid-to-high-end developer, emphasizing quality design, construction, and community amenities to differentiate in a highly competitive market. However, the company has faced substantial challenges due to the broader Chinese property sector crisis, including liquidity constraints, declining sales, and regulatory pressures aimed at curbing debt and speculation in the real estate market.

Key Risks
- Regulatory: Subject to Chinese government policies aimed at controlling property market speculation, including restrictions on borrowing, home purchases, and pricing. The company has also faced increased scrutiny under the 'three red lines' policy designed to reduce leverage in the sector.
- Competitive: Operates in an intensely competitive market with numerous large developers (e.g., Country Garden, Evergrande). Market share has been eroded by sector-wide distress and declining consumer confidence.
- Financial: High levels of debt and liquidity shortages have been reported, with challenges in meeting obligations and accessing financing. Credit downgrades and default risks have been noted by rating agencies.
- Operational: Execution risks due to funding constraints, potential delays in project completions, and reliance on presales amid weakening demand.
